RCHS senior Dawn Watson has been awarded the $10,000 Bridgewater College President’s scholarship. The Sperryville senior beat students from five states in an on-campus competition which included written essays and individual interviews with faculty members and administrators. The students also were judged on their academic records.
Dawn is an honor roll student in Rappahannock and a member of the Pop Quiz team. She’s active in dramatics and choral music and was one of last year’s participants in the GoverSchool

Sets Up Shop The student Book Fair at the elementary school starts Tuesday, according to RCES librarian Lucia Kilby. Pupils and parents alike are invited to browse among the specially-ordered books that will be on display. The books are chosen to reinforce reading skills and to hold a child’s interest. Kilby says the Book Fair is one of the best answers to the often repeated parental question: How can we make our children read? The paperback books cover a wide range of interests and are color-coded by topic. Prices range from 69* to $5.50 with the majority of them approximately $2. Kilby says proceeds from the sale will go towards additional books and materials for the school library.
